Julia Fitzgerald. Royal Slave. New York: Bart Books, 1978.

During a time when the Barbary Corsairs roamed the seas in search of slaves, young Englishwoman Cassia Morbilly is abducted from the coast of Cornwall on the eve of her elopement with the man she loves.

Seduced by the French sea captain who has abducted her, Cassia learns to love her captor but is devastated when she learns that he is still determined to sell her to the highest bidder in the slave markets of North Africa. And so Cassia becomes a Sultan's plaything--a favoured concubine imprisoned amid the barbaric splendors of the harem.
